Dubai Resident Receives Discounted Liver Transplant in India, Returns Home for a New Lease on Life

Dubai Resident Receives Discounted Liver Transplant in India, Returns Home for a New Lease on Life Read More »

Dubai Resident Receives Discounted Liver Transplant in India Returns Home for a New Lease on Life
Scroll to Top